Creamy Avocado Citrus Dressing

Creamy Avocado Citrus Dressing

This is a lovely, thick, flavorful dressing that doesn't use much oil. The avocado thickens it while the citrus juices, cilantro, and jalapeno add plenty of flavor. This recipe was inspired by a recipe in the Raw Food, Real World book - with a few minor adjustments!

Ingredients:

  • 1 medium avocado
  • 1 C fresh orange juice
  • 1/3 C fresh lime juice
  • 1/4 cup white or yellow onion
  • 1/2 of a small jalapeno pepper, seeds removed
  • 1 generous handful of cilantro
  • 1/4 C extra virgin olive oil
  • salt & pepper to taste

Preparation:

  1. Put all ingredients except the olive oil in a high speed blender or food processor.
  2. Blend until thoroughly combined.
  3. With the machine still running, stream in the olive oil so that the mixture will emulsify.

Five Ways to Enjoy Avocado

Five Ways to Enjoy Avocado

Avocados are one of nature's super fruits - super tasty and super versatile! They are nutrient dense, full of vitamins and anti-oxidants including vitamin C, vitamin K, vitamin E, vitamin B6, folate, magnesium, lutein, potassium, and beta-carotene. They contain good fats and are naturally sodium and cholesterol free. Avocados can act as a “nutrient booster” by helping increase the absorption of fat-soluble nutrients like vitamins A, D, K, and E. PLUS they are delish!

Check out these five ways to enjoy more avocados as part of a healthy plant-based diet.
  1. Avocado toast! Spread ripe avocado on your choice of toast as you would vegan buttery spread or vegan cream cheese. Top with chopped cilantro, lime juice, and sea salt, and you have a tasty, hearty, healthful breakfast or snack.
